Terpene Profile and Chemistry
The terpene backbone of Lemon Cane V2 is limonene-forward, consistent with the loud citrus on both nose and palate. In top-shelf lemon phenotypes, limonene concentrations commonly range from 0.3% to 0.8% by weight within total terpene pools of 1.5–3.0%. Supporting terpenes typically include beta-caryophyllene, myrcene, linalool, and humulene in varying ratios.
Beta-caryophyllene, often measured around 0.2–0.6% in comparable hybrids, brings peppery warmth and may contribute to perceived body effects via CB2 receptor activity. Linalool, even at modest levels of 0.05–0.25%, can soften the citrus edge with a floral sweetness and is associated with calming properties. Myrcene in the 0.1–0.5% band can add a touch of herbal depth and amplify perceived relaxation.

Flowering Time, Yield, and Growth Windows
Growers report that Lemon Cane V2 typically finishes within 8–10 weeks of bloom under 12/12, consistent with many lemon-forward hybrids. This range mirrors data from citrus-dominant seed lines that commonly list 56–70 days of flower as a target window. Environmental control and phenotype selection are the main determinants of leaning early or late within that range.
Indoor yields of 450–600 g/m² are achievable with strong canopy management, dense lighting, and a dialed feed program. Outdoor or greenhouse plants, given full-season veg and proper support, can produce 500–900 g per plant in favorable climates. Stretch from flip is moderate, around 30–60%, allowing for a relatively compact stack under low ceilings.
Clone rooting is brisk in healthy stock, generally taking 7–14 days with 0.2–0.6% IBA gel or powder and 80–95% humidity. Seedlings show early vigor and respond well to topping by node 4–6. A veg period of 3–5 weeks is typical for a single-layer SCROG, depending on pot size and plant count.
Environment and Climate Targets
Veg thrives at 24–27 C with 60–70% RH, delivering a VPD near 0.8–1.0 kPa for fast leaf expansion. Flowering is best at 23–26 C lights on with 50–60% RH in weeks 1–4, tapering to 45–50% RH by late flower for mold prevention. Night temps 2–3 C lower than day help preserve internodal tightness without shocking metabolism.
Airflow is essential for dense lemon flowers that carry heavy resin loads. Aim for 20–30 total air exchanges per hour and ensure no dead zones behind canopy walls. Oscillating fans should gently ripple leaves without folding them, suggesting optimal boundary-layer disruption.
Intake filtration and negative pressure help prevent powdery mildew and pest incursions. Lemon-forward hybrids resent stagnant air more than some broader-leaf indicas due to their tighter stacks. Keep HVAC maintenance and filter changes on schedule to stabilize environment and aroma integrity.
Substrate, Nutrition, and Irrigation Strategy
Coco or soil-less blends provide fast growth and easy steering; buffered coco with 30–40% perlite supports aggressive dry-backs. In living soil, a medium N base amended with calcium, magnesium, sulfur, and micronutrients lays a strong foundation for terpene expression. Maintain soil pH at 6.2–6.8, or 5.8–6.2 in hydro/coco, to keep key ions soluble.
Feed EC targets can start at 1.2–1.6 mS/cm in late veg, rise to 1.8–2.2 in early flower, and peak around 2.0–2.4 in mid bloom. Reduce nitrogen after week 3–4 of flower while emphasizing potassium, phosphorus, and sulfur for terpene and oil production. Calcium and magnesium stability is crucial under high-intensity LEDs, which can increase demand by 10–20% compared to HPS.
Irrigation frequency should respect pot size and dry-back goals, generally allowing 20–30% of container water capacity to transpire between waterings. In coco, aim for 10–20% runoff per feed to prevent salt accumulation and keep root zone EC stable. Root zone oxygenation correlates strongly with resin output, so avoid chronic saturation.
Training, Canopy Management, and Plant Density
Lemon Cane V2 responds well to topping once or twice, followed by low-stress training to build a flat, even canopy. A single trellis layer can suffice, but two layers offer better support for dense colas in weeks 5–8. Defoliation should be conservative and targeted, removing large fan leaves that cast deep shadows while preserving enough for photosynthesis.
For SCROG, plan on 1.0–1.5 plants per square meter depending on veg time and pot size. Flip to flower when plants fill 70–80% of the net, anticipating a 30–60% stretch to complete the weaving. For SOG, many smaller plants can be flowered with minimal topping, focusing on fast turnover and single-cola production.
Branch selection is important because this cultivar builds weight late in bloom. Prune weak, low interior growth to concentrate resources on top sites that receive the most PPFD. Good structure reduces larf and simplifies post-harvest work.
Lighting Intensity, Spectrum, and CO2
Under LEDs, target 500–700 PPFD in late veg and 900–1200 PPFD in mid-to-late flower for best results. If supplementing CO2 to 1000–1200 ppm, PPFD can be raised to 1100–1400 with appropriate temperature and VPD support. Keep daily light integral (DLI) in veg around 25–35 mol/m²/day and 40–55 mol/m²/day in flower as a broad guideline.
Full-spectrum white LEDs with added 660 nm deep red drive robust flowering and tight bud formation. A modest 730 nm far-red bump can facilitate Emerson effect synergies and encourage efficient flowering transitions. Blue fraction near 10–15% in veg helps manage internodes and improve leaf thickness.
Lamp distance should be fine-tuned by PAR mapping and leaf feedback rather than fixed numbers. Watch for light stress signs such as leaf edge curl or chlorosis at tops and ease back if necessary. Incremental increases across weeks 1–4 of bloom help plants acclimate without shock.
VPD, Air, and Water Management
Aim for VPD of 0.8–1.0 kPa during early veg, increasing to 1.1–1.3 in early flower and 1.3–1.5 in late flower. These targets support steady transpiration, nutrient flow, and resin formation while reducing mold pressure. Use reliable sensors at canopy height for accurate readings.
Dehumidification capacity should match transpiration rates, often 0.7–1.2 liters per square meter per day in peak bloom for dense canopies. Stagger irrigation timing so runoff is not peaking during lights off, which can spike humidity. Consider a short “dry window” before lights off in late flower to mitigate overnight RH creep.
Root zone temperatures should stay in the 19–22 C range to keep dissolved oxygen high and roots metabolically active. Chilled nutrient solution in hydro systems can reduce pythium risk and keep EC on target. Good root health is one of the strongest predictors of potency and terpene quality.
Pest, Pathogen, and IPM Considerations
Dense, resinous lemon flowers warrant vigilant powdery mildew prevention. Keep late flower RH under 50% where possible, ensure strong air movement, and avoid foliar sprays past week three. Sanitation and intake filtration are first-line defenses against spores and insect hitchhikers.
An integrated pest management program using biologics can keep common pests at bay. Predatory mites like Amblyseius swirskii and Cucumeris help suppress thrips and fungus gnats, while Hypoaspis miles targets larvae in the medium. Sticky cards and weekly leaf scouting let you observe trends before they escalate.
While limonene is discussed in literature for antifungal and antibacterial properties in vitro, it is not a substitute for robust IPM. The cultivar’s value warrants redundancy across cultural, biological, and mechanical controls. Quarantine any new clones for 10–14 days to verify pest-free status before canopy integration.
Harvest Timing, Drying, and Curing for Maximum Citrus
Harvest timing strongly influences the balance between zesty uplift and heavier body effects. For a brighter profile, many growers cut when trichomes show mostly cloudy with 5–10% amber. For a rounder, more relaxing effect, waiting for 15–25% amber is common.
A controlled dry at approximately 60 F and 60% RH for 10–14 days preserves monoterpenes like limonene and linalool. Gentle air movement that does not billow buds reduces external drying while allowing internal moisture to migrate. Stems should snap, not bend, before moving to cure.
Cure in airtight containers at 60–65 F and 58–62% RH, burping daily for the first week and then weekly for 3–4 weeks. Moisture meters or humidity packs help stabilize the cure and prevent terpene volatility. Properly cured Lemon Cane V2 often exhibits improved sweetness and cleaner gas undertones after 21–28 days.
